Memory care in Coleta offers 24-hour care and supervision, trained staff, and specialized activities to accommodate the needs of seniors with Alzheimer’s or dementia. These communities typically offer advanced security features and engaging activities to help ensure residents’ well-being. The cost of memory care in Coleta is about $4,537 per month. Cost of memory care in Coleta, IL

The average cost of senior living in Coleta is $4,537 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Savanna, IL with an average of $3,980 per month.

State regulations for memory care in Coleta

Safety is a primary concern when seniors and their families look for memory care. Each state has its own laws and inspection processes to help ensure seniors reside in a safe environment and receive quality care.
